Eutrophication And Its Effects On The Ecosystem

Eutrophication is a situation whereby water is enriched by excess nutrient salts (phosphates and nitrates), which, in the long run, alters the physical composition of the ecosystem. The changes caused include the death of fish species, aquatic plants and algae growth increases, there is also the decline of the quality of water. Trophic State Index For Lakes

Eutrophication is the excessive enrichment of water bodies with nutrients and minerals due to unregulated water runoff into the water bodies. This intern increases the growth of plants such as algae in the water bodies, which reduces the oxygen concentration in the water bodies.
